CF835B.The number on the board

传统题 时间 2000 ms 内存 256 MiB 5 尝试 1 已通过 1 标签

The number on the board

题目描述

某个自然数被写在了黑板上。它的各位数字之和不少于 kk。但你一时分心,有人将这个数改成了 nn,把某些数字替换成了其他数字。已知数字的长度没有发生变化。

你需要找出这两个数在最少多少位上可能不同。

输入格式

第一行包含整数 kk1k1091 \leq k \leq 10^{9})。

第二行包含整数 nn1n<101000001 \leq n < 10^{100000})。

nn 没有前导零。保证这样的情况一定可能发生。

输出格式

输出初始数字和 nn 在最少多少位上可能不同。

说明/提示

在第一个样例中,初始数字可以是 1212

在第二个样例中,nn 的各位数字之和不小于 kk,初始数字可以等于 nn

由 ChatGPT 5 翻译

样例

3
11
1
3
99
0

在线编程 IDE

建议全屏模式获得最佳体验